CWC2023 : South Africa outplayed Sri Lanka in a run fest with 3 100s , Bangladesh rout Afghans


South Africa got a resounding  big win in the first match of the World Cup.  They beat Sri Lanka by 102 runs.  Three batsmen Quinton de Kock, Rassie van der Dusen and Aiden Markram played a big role in South Africa's win.  All three made dazzling hundreds.  Batting first, South Africa scored a massive 428 runs for 5 wickets.  Sri Lanka could not reach the target despite some brave  efforts.  They were all out for 326 runs.


 Sri Lanka captain Dasun Shanaka won the toss and decided to bowl.  South African captain Temba Bavuma got out early lbw to Madhusanka , but Quinton de Kock and Van der Dussen made double century stand for the second wicket.  This is de Kock's last World Cup.  It seems that he is playing with the joy of his heart.  Both the batsmen played aggressive cricket and did not give the Sri Lankan bowlers a chance to settle down.  From pacer to spinner, they did not spare  anyone.  De Kock completed his dazzling  century in just 82 balls with the help of countless classic shots . Some of his driving ,  pulling and flicks off his legs were imperious  .  He got out after reaching 100 runs while hitting a big shot.  Van der Dusen was dismissed for 108 runs after playing another glorious ODI innings thus stamping his consistency. 


 It was Markram who thrived  on the foundation laid by the two batsmen.  Markram first had stands  with Heinrich Klaasen (32) and then David Miller (34*) .  He played aggressive cricket from the first ball.  Markram scored a hundred in just 49 balls.  This is the fastest hundred in World Cup history.  In 2011, Ireland's Kevin O'Brien scored a 50-ball hundred against England on Indian soil.  That was the fastest century so far.  Markram broke that record.  He played a blistering  innings of 106 runs off just  a mere  54 balls. Markram played his shots with brute force but all were delightful cricketing shots.  On this day he completely decimated the Sri Lankan bowling to pile on an electrifying hundred . 


  In the end, South Africa scored 428 runs which was going to be a too big  for Sri Lanka  to chase it down . 




Chasing this run was not easy for Sri Lanka.  They lost the wicket of Pathum Nissanka in the beginning.  Kushal Perera also did not stay long .  Kusal Mendis and Charith Ashalanka fought for Sri Lanka.  Mendis scored a breathtaking 76 off 42 balls as he was striking the ball with great power and finesse hitting 8 sixes in all. Mendis was hoisting the fast  bowlers repeatedly through the square leg area in to the stands .  After Mendis departed , Assalanka scored a glorious 79 runs off 65 balls.  As the target was huge, the Sri Lankan batsmen had no choice but to play big shots and thereby kept losing wickets .    Shanaka later scored 68 runs off 62 balls to get back some form.  


  Among the South African bowlers, Gerald Coetzee took 3 wickets and Marco Jansen, Kagiso Rabada and Keshav Maharaj took 2 wickets each.  Lungi Ngidi took 1 wicket.  In the end, Sri Lanka were all out for 326 runs in 44.5 overs.  They lost the match by 102 runs. Markram was the player of the match for his record breaking century .




Meanwhile the Bengal Tigers defeated Afghanistan in the first match.  Afghanistan is a good team in 50 over format.  Bangladesh defeated that Afghanistan on Saturday.  The Afghans scored 156 runs batting first.  Afghanistan could not bat the entire 50 overs.  They ended in 37.2 overs.  In reply, Bangladesh picked up the required runs to win in 34.4 overs.  Bangladesh won the match with 92 balls left.


 Shakib came down on Saturday.  He took three wickets with the ball.  However, the champion all-rounder could not score more runs with the bat.  Shakib (14) got out just before the end of the match.



 No one except Afghanistan's Rahmatullah Gurbaz scored special runs against Bangladesh.  Gurbaz scored 47 runs off 62 balls.  He made the highest runs.  The rest surrendered before the Bangladeshi bowlers as Afghanistan slumped from 120/2 to 156 all out .  .  Along with Shakib, Mehdi Hasan Miraj also took three wickets.  Mehdi Hasan is also successful with the bat.  He scored a fluent  57 runs to get the player of the match  .  Nazmul Hossain Shanto (59) and Mushfiqur Rahim did the rest.  They gave victory to Bangladesh in the first match of the World Cup.
